NORTHWOODS MUFFINS
Even family and friends who aren't fond of wild rice rave about these golden muffins flecked with colorful blueberries and cranberries. They're a terrific take-along treat.
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 30m
Yield 16 muffins.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t. In another bowl, whisk the eggs, buttermilk and butter. Stir in d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the rice, blueberries and cranberries. ,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ups two-thirds full. Bake at 375° for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ks. Serve warm.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 134 calories, Fat 4g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 35mg cholesterol, Sodium 198mg sodium, Carbohydrate 22g carbohydrate (8g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 3g protein.
WILD RICE-CORN MUFFINS
Betty Crocker's Heart Healthy Cookbook shares a recipe! Bake these delicious wild rice and cornmeal muffins with a fruity hint to them - serve warm in just 35 minutes!
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Side Dish
Time 35m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Heat oven to 400°. Spray 12 medium muffin cups, 2 1/2x1 1/4 inches, with cooking spray, or line with paper baking cups. Mix milk, oil and egg product in large bowl.
- Stir in flour, sugar, cornmeal, baking powder and salt all at once just until flour is moistened. Fold in wild rice and cranberries. Divide batter evenly among muffin cups.
- Bake 20 to 25 minutes or until golden brown. Immediately remove from pan. Serve warm.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 150, Carbohydrate 25 g, Cholesterol 0 mg, Fat 1, Fiber 0 g, Protein 3 g, SaturatedFat 0 g, ServingSize 1 Muffin, Sodium 170 mg, Sugar 9 g, TransFat 0 g

HAZELNUT WILD RICE MUFFINS
Steps:
- 1. In a medium saucepan, cover the rice with 1 inch of water. Cover and simmer over moderately low heat until tender, about 20 minutes. Drain and cool. 2. Preheat oven to 400. Butter a 12-cup muffin pan. In a pie plate, toast the nuts 10 min, until the skins blister. Rub off skins in a kitchen towel, and finely chop nuts. Raise oven to 425. 3. In medium bowl, beat melted butter, eggs, and sugar. Stir in the cooked rice, the onion, and the nuts. 4. In another bowl, sift together flour, b.p., and salt. Stir dry ingredients into wet just intil incorporated. 5. Fill muffin cups 2/3 full. Bake at 425 for about 20 minutes, until golden brown. Let cool in pan 2 min, turn onto rack. Muffins can be frozen 1 month.

WILD RICE, MUSHROOM, AND HAZELNUT STUFFING
Make and share this Wild Rice, Mushroom, and Hazelnut Stuffing recipe from Food.com.
Provided by ratherbeswimmin
Categories < 4 Hours
Time 2h15m
Yield 10 cups
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Add the dried cherries to a small bowl and add in the port wine; let stand while making the stuffing.
- Bring a big pot of lightly salted water to a boil over high heat; add in the wild rice; decrease heat to medium.
- Boil uncovered until the rice is barely tender (some of the grains may have burst), about 45 minutes.
- Drain the rice into a sieve and rinse under cold water until cooled; drain well and place in a large bowl.
- In a very large skillet or flameproof casserole, melt 2 tablespoons of butter over medium heat.
- Add in the leeks and cook/stir often, until tender, about 5 minutes; add to the wild rice.
- In the same skillet, melt the remaining 2 tablespoons butter; add in the mushrooms and cook over med-high heat, stirring occasionally, until the mushrooms give off their juices, about 5 minutes.
- Add in the port with cherries and the poultry seasoning and boil until the liquid is reduced to about 1/2 cup, 6-8 minutes.
- Stir the mushrooms and port into the bowl of wild rice; add in the hazelnuts, parsley, salt, and pepper; mix well.
- Transfer to a lightly buttered casserole, drizzle with broth, cover, and bake in preheated 350° oven until heated, about 30 minutes (for crustier stuffing, remove cover for last 15 minutes of cook time).
ORANGE HAZELNUT MUFFINS
My own recipe, to use up some ground hazelnuts - very happy with these tasty little treats! Lower in cholesterol, too.
Provided by catxx
Categories Quick Breads
Time 30m
Yield 12 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 180°C.
- Lightly spray muffin tray with olive oil spray or line with paper muffin cases.
- Sift flour, bicarb soda and baking powder together in large mixing bowl, and stir in ground hazelnuts, brown sugar, grated rind and choc bits.
- In another bowl, whisk together eggs, oil, juice and milk.
- Pour liquid ingredients into dry ingredients and mix very lightly till just combined.
- Bake for approx 20 minutes or until lightly golden.
- Cool on wire rack.
- Optional: Brush tops of still-warm muffins with marmalade, and allow to cool.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 249.4, Fat 14.2, SaturatedFat 2.6, Cholesterol 31, Sodium 330.2, Carbohydrate 28.5, Fiber 1.3, Sugar 14.9, Protein 3.7
